The distribution of the Sponges in a sciophilous habitat constitute of several crevices and cornices of tbe intertidal area of Aramar beach (Luanco, Asturias, North of Spain). The abundance index and habitat preferences for each species are given. 20 species were found, 3 of tbem are Calcarea and 17 Demospongiaria. 2 Demospongiaria species (Dysidea avara and Oíígoceras collectrix) are first records in the Spanish Atlantic Coasts, and other 3 Demospongiaria species (Stelligera rígida, Antho involvens and Halichondria bowerbanki) are new records for the East síde of the Bay of Biscay.
